回火温度对50Mn18Cr4WN应力腐蚀开裂倾向性的影响

摘    要:本文用裂纹试件研究了回火温度对50Mn18Cr4WN护环钢应力腐蚀开裂的影响。由试验结果可知回火会使K_((?)scc)(平面应变条件下的应力腐蚀开裂门槛值)改变.

The Effect of Tempering Temperature on 50Mn18Cr4WN Stress Corrosion Cracking

Abstract:The effect of tempering temperature on 50Mn18Cr4WN stress corrosion cracking is described in this paper. By the testing, it will be found that tempering makes the K_(1scc)(stress corrosion cracking threshold level for plane strain condition) changed.
